Output 7c77e621a8fc197e2854f971ce5e011380dcc3f0025c5d23a41a27432a516d0e:1

value
15244430000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 530bb6dca916bc7cab0c5b3fb1dc4b74f3362a04 OP_EQUALVERIFY OP_CHECKSIG
address
18a77r5BgMjhqinN4msMZ6yas4ZXBQtyhP
transaction
7c77e621a8fc197e2854f971ce5e011380dcc3f0025c5d23a41a27432a516d0e
spent
true